  2. The Bozo Show -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/The_Bozo_Show

    The player attempted to toss ping-pong balls into six numbered buckets in sequence, each set farther away than the one before it, and won a prize of increasing value for each one hit. The game ended when the player either missed a bucket or hit all six of them; in the latter case, he/she won a cash bonus, a bicycle, and (in later years) a trip.

  4. Table squash -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Table_squash

    The game was created in 2009 in Leeds, United Kingdom. [1] Originally played using a domestic kitchen table, considerably smaller than a table tennis table, the game was created as an alternative to traditional table tennis for locations where there isn't room for a full size table and room to navigate around it.
